With MP4:Beyond finally having been released, it feels a little weird to think that we no longer have any more of those “Release Date: TBA” games from Nintendo: Bayo3, Pikmin 4, BotW2, and MP4:Beyond have all finally been released. It’s almost a surreal thought…
Seems Nintendo isn’t looking to do any more of these “revealed too soon” style of releases judging by upcoming releases. I’m curious how quick of a marketing cycle games such as 3D Mario and Zelda will get moving forward: Wonder had 4 months, Odyssey had 10 months, but BotW/TotK both had 4-5y.
